## Limits & Quotas: Reset Flow Revamp

Heads up, plugin folks — the new password reset flow in Lockwren ships with tighter quotas than the old one. Reset emails are rate-limited per account and per origin, so if your plugin triggers resets programmatically, expect throttling once you cross the hourly ceiling. Token lifetimes also shrank, which means cached reset links go stale faster. Don't hardcode anything; pull these from the config endpoint instead. The current defaults are listed below.

tuning constants:
QUOTAS = {
    "druwyn": 5,
    "holix": 5,
    "zorath": 5,
    "holwyn": 10,
}

Subject: DR drill — WaveGlance preview service. Team: Thursday we fail over the waveform renderer to the Kestrel site. Expect brief preview gaps; transcodes queue as normal. Security reviewers should confirm the sealed config bundle opens cleanly on the standby nodes before we flip traffic. The bundle is encrypted at rest. To unseal it during the drill, use the recovery passphrase that follows on the next line:

unlock words, fahog-yahof: belael-holael-eliius-joreth-tamax-olimir-norwyn-holwyn-fraath-lamius-norwyn-druys-soriel

MEMO — Kettling Depot Receiving

Uniform sets for the new Kettling depot arrive Wednesday via Ashgrove courier: 40 boxes, sorted by size, manifest attached to box one. Check the count at the dock before signing; shortages go straight to stores, not the courier. The hand-over instruction the courier will follow is set out below.

drop instructions, tafof-baguf: the holmir gilox courier leaves the sormir ulaok holdor ledger at gate 5596 under passcode 257343

## Add batch email digest scheduling

Moves digest assembly off the per-user cron into a batched scheduler. Digests are grouped by timezone bucket, assembled in one pass, and handed to the Quillpost sender with jittered dispatch to avoid the 9am spike. No schema changes; the old path stays behind a flag for one release. The constants below drove our staging numbers.

limits module of fajog-tawig:
RATE_LIMITS = {
    "druwyn": 2,
    "quenael": 10,
    "wenix": 2,
    "druael": 2,
}